The equation of the common tangent with positive slope to the parabola `y^(2)=8sqrt(3)x` and hyperbola `4x^(2)-y^(2)=4` is

A

`y=sqrt(6)x+sqrt(2)`

B

`y=sqrt(6)x-sqrt(2)`

C

`y=sqrt(3)x+sqrt(2)`

D

`y=sqrt(3)x-sqrt(2)`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
A
